//-----------------------------------------------------------------------------
|
||||
//
|
||||
// exrmaketiled -- program that produces tiled
|
||||
// multiresolution versions of OpenEXR images.
|
||||
//
|
||||
//-----------------------------------------------------------------------------
|
||||
|
||||
#include "makeTiled.h"
|
||||
|
||||
#include <iostream>
|
||||
#include <exception>
|
||||
#include <string>
|
||||
#include <string.h>
|
||||
#include <stdlib.h>
|
||||
|
||||
#include "namespaceAlias.h"
|
||||
using namespace IMF;
|
||||
using namespace std;
|
||||
|
||||
|
||||
|
||||
namespace {
|
||||
|
||||
void
|
||||
usageMessage (const char argv0[], bool verbose = false)
|
||||
{
|
||||
cerr << "usage: " << argv0 << " [options] infile outfile" << endl;
|
||||
|
||||
if (verbose)
|
||||
{
|
||||
cerr << "\n"
|
||||
"Reads an OpenEXR image from infile, produces a tiled\n"
|
||||
"version of the image, and saves the result in outfile.\n"
|
||||
"\n"
|
||||
"Options:\n"
|
||||
"\n"
|
||||
"-o produces a ONE_LEVEL image (default)\n"
|
||||
"\n"
|
||||
"-m produces a MIPMAP_LEVELS multiresolution image\n"
|
||||
"\n"
|
||||
"-r produces a RIPMAP_LEVELS multiresolution image\n"
|
||||
"\n"
|
||||
"-f c when a MIPMAP_LEVELS or RIPMAP_LEVELS image\n"
|
||||
" is produced, image channel c will be resampled\n"
|
||||
" without low-pass filtering. This option can\n"
|
||||
" be specified multiple times to disable low-pass\n"
|
||||
" filtering for mutiple channels.\n"
|
||||
"\n"
|
||||
"-e x y when a MIPMAP_LEVELS or RIPMAP_LEVELS image\n"
|
||||
" is produced, low-pass filtering takes samples\n"
|
||||
" outside the image's data window. This requires\n"
|
||||
" extrapolating the image. Option -e specifies\n"
|
||||
" how the image is extrapolated horizontally and\n"
|
||||
" vertically (black/clamp/periodic/mirror, default\n"
|
||||
" is clamp).\n"
|
||||
"\n"
|
||||
"-t x y sets the tile size in the output image to\n"
|
||||
" x by y pixels (default is 64 by 64)\n"
|
||||
"\n"
|
||||
"-d sets level size rounding to ROUND_DOWN (default)\n"
|
||||
"\n"
|
||||
"-u sets level size rounding to ROUND_UP\n"
|
||||
"\n"
|
||||
"-z x sets the data compression method to x\n"
|
||||
" (none/rle/zip/piz/pxr24/b44/b44a/dwaa/dwab,\n"
|
||||
" default is zip)\n"
|
||||
"\n"
|
||||
"-v verbose mode\n"
|
||||
"\n"
|
||||
"-h prints this message\n"
|
||||
"\n"
|
||||
"Multipart Options:\n"
|
||||
"\n"
|
||||
"-p i part number, default is 0\n";
|
||||
|
||||
cerr << endl;
|
||||
}
|
||||
|
||||
exit (1);
|
||||
}
